Your diagnosis raises the chance that your child will develop bipolar disorder compared with some families without that history. It does not determine your child’s future. There is no single inheritance percentage that can answer the question for one child, and a consumer DNA test cannot settle it.
The useful response is to know the family history, support ordinary health and development, and seek assessment for clear changes without turning childhood into surveillance. Heritability describes patterns in a population. It is not the chance that your child inherits a diagnosis or the share of their life caused by genes. MedlinePlus Genetics explains this often-confused term.1

What heritability actually tells us
Researchers use heritability to describe how much variation in a trait within a studied population is associated with genetic differences under particular conditions. It is a statistical description of that population. It does not divide a person into a genetic part and an environmental part.
An illness can be highly heritable without being inevitable in the child of an affected parent. Family members also share more than DNA. They may share environments, experiences, access to care, and ways of recognizing symptoms. Family patterns therefore require careful interpretation.
A map of possible routes offers one limited image. Inherited susceptibility may affect which possibilities are more likely, but it does not fix a destination. The analogy stops there: genes and life do not provide a mapped prediction for one child.
It may help to separate three questions. Does bipolar disorder occur more often in some families? Yes. Do inherited differences add to that pattern? Yes. Can we use a parent’s diagnosis or current genetic test to know what will happen to this child? No.
A risk estimate needs an outcome and an age
A study may count bipolar I, bipolar II, a broader bipolar-spectrum diagnosis, any mood disorder, or any mental illness. Those are different outcomes. A figure for depression or any psychiatric diagnosis should not be presented as the chance of inheriting bipolar disorder.
Age matters just as much. A child followed into adolescence has not had the same observation period as someone followed into middle age. A teenage study’s current diagnoses cannot be compared with an adult lifetime estimate as if both answer the same question.
Where families were recruited matters too. A specialist clinic may include people with more severe illness or more concern about their children. A register may miss people who never receive a diagnosis in the recorded healthcare system. Neither design is useless, but they can produce different estimates.
This is why a careful answer may sound less tidy than an online percentage. It is preserving the meaning of the number. Your clinician should be able to explain who was studied, what was counted, and how long the study followed them.
One comparison with matching outcomes
A Danish register study estimated diagnosed bipolar disorder through age 52 using the same methods across parental groups. It offers a compatible comparison, with important limits:
| Parental group in the study | Estimated offspring bipolar diagnosis by age 52 |
|---|---|
| Neither parent had been psychiatrically admitted | About 0.5 per 100 |
| One parent had bipolar disorder; the other had never been psychiatrically admitted | About 4 per 100 |
| Both parents had bipolar disorder | About 25 per 100, with a wide uncertainty range of about 14–36 per 100 |
These were age-adjusted cumulative estimates, not simply the fraction of observed cases divided by children enrolled. The two-parent group was small: 146 offspring, with 15 observed diagnoses contributing to the age-adjusted estimate. The first row is a specific comparison group, not every family in the general population. Gottesman and colleagues provide the original methods and results.2
The table does not predict a particular U.S. child’s outcome. It reflects historical Danish healthcare records and does not cleanly separate bipolar I from II. It also cannot tell us how much of the difference was caused by genes alone.
Other studies find different absolute rates because ages, definitions, and recruitment differ. A large 2023 review combined high-risk family studies and registers, including broader bipolar categories. Its results should not be reduced to one universal inheritance figure. The full review makes the variation visible.3
What if both parents have bipolar disorder?
Evidence supports greater familial risk when both parents are affected, but precision is limited. Two-parent groups are often small and may differ in illness severity or how they entered a study. The estimate in the table is not a verdict on a couple’s choice to have children.
A 2026 Swedish study also found a stronger familial association with two affected parents. It used different ages, family-selection rules, and a bipolar I-focused outcome. It cannot be treated as a direct replacement for the Danish percentage. The newer register study supports the direction of concern while leaving personal prediction uncertain.4
This information can guide a planning conversation about support, family history, and access to care. It should not be used to assign blame to either parent or suggest that a child’s identity is defined by a risk group.
There is no single bipolar gene
Bipolar disorder involves many genetic differences, each generally contributing a small part to susceptibility. Some genetic influences overlap with other psychiatric conditions. That helps explain why family histories can include different diagnoses rather than one exact pattern.
A large 2025 genetic study identified many associated regions across the genome. It combined different ancestries and sources of diagnoses, including clinical and self-reported information. Finding an association across many people is a scientific discovery; it is not a validated test that predicts one child’s future. The original Nature report supports the many-variant picture.5
Polygenic scores combine many genetic variants into a research estimate. Their meaning can change across ancestry groups and study settings. A score that helps research does not by itself have the accuracy or clinical usefulness needed for decisions about one child.
The International Society of Psychiatric Genetics advises against using current common-variant risk testing to diagnose psychiatric illness or identify an individual as destined to develop it. Consumer testing should not be treated as an answer to this family question. Testing related to drug metabolism is also a different issue from predicting a diagnosis. The society’s statement explains these limits.6
Early concerns are not inevitable stages
Prospective studies of children with an affected parent help researchers observe development over time. Some find that sleep problems, anxiety, or depression precede later bipolar illness in a subset. Those concerns are not specific to bipolar disorder and do not mean that a child is moving through a fixed sequence.
In a U.S. offspring study, clear episode-like activation was associated with later bipolar outcomes. That does not turn a website list into a screening tool. The study used repeated clinical reviews and comparison groups. Axelson and colleagues studied research-defined patterns, not ordinary moodiness.7
Canadian and Dutch follow-up studies also show why the observation period matters.8 Outcomes can look different when children are followed into adulthood, and not everyone returns for each assessment. The findings do not establish that risk ends at a particular birthday or that all early distress predicts bipolar disorder. The Dutch long-term follow-up adds that perspective.9
If your child has anxiety, depression, or a sleep problem, that problem deserves care for its own effects now. It should not be treated only as a possible sign of a future diagnosis. Helping with current distress does not require certainty about the eventual course.
Notice a change, then ask about its impact
One late night, a burst of enthusiasm, an argument, or an irritable afternoon does not diagnose bipolar disorder. Look at whether there is a sustained, clear change from the young person’s usual sleep need, energy, mood, behavior, judgment, or function.
Several changes together may deserve closer attention. For example, markedly reduced need for sleep alongside unusual drive, much faster speech, and risky judgment is different from being tired after studying late. Psychosis or major impairment also needs assessment.
This is not a set of thresholds for parents to score. The child’s age, development, other conditions, substances, medicines, and life events matter. ADHD, anxiety, depression, trauma-related symptoms, and sleep problems can overlap. NIMH’s child and teen resource recommends trained assessment.10
Ask what the young person notices. “You seem to be sleeping less and having a hard time at school. How has it felt to you?” invites information. “You are becoming bipolar like me” imposes a conclusion and can make honest discussion harder.
Significant impairment should not be dismissed as “just a teenager.” A family can avoid overlabeling while still taking distress, dangerous behavior, or a sharp change seriously. The aim is to understand and respond, not to choose between alarm and denial.
Support a life larger than risk
Sleep opportunity, predictable support, help with distress, and avoiding substance-related harm are sensible health supports. They do not promise to prevent bipolar disorder. A child should not feel that a late night or a difficult week has caused an illness.
Support can be ordinary and collaborative. Ask which routines help and which feel impossible. Make room for friendships, interests, privacy, and the young person’s own goals. You do not need a daily mood report to show that you care.
Do not recommend psychiatric medication solely because a child has a family history. If treatment is proposed for current symptoms or another diagnosis, ask what problem it addresses and what evidence supports it. Family risk may inform assessment without becoming the diagnosis itself.
Your own care also matters, but your child should not be made responsible for keeping you well. Adults can arrange support for your treatment and episodes. A young person can know whom to contact without becoming the family’s monitor or emergency coordinator.
Talk about history without handing over a burden
Hypothetical conversation with a teenager: “I have bipolar disorder. It can affect mood, energy, and sleep in ways that need treatment. It sometimes runs in families, but that does not tell us what will happen to you. You are not responsible for my health. If something about your mood or sleep worries you, we can get help understanding it.”
Then leave room for questions. “What have you heard about it?” or “Is there anything you have been worried to ask?” may be more useful than giving a long speech. Adapt the detail to age, readiness, and what the young person already knows.
You can also admit uncertainty. “I cannot promise what the future will be, but we do not have to label you to take a concern seriously.” Avoid secrets that make illness feel shameful, while preserving the child’s choice about what to tell peers.
Let the young person have a say
Ask how they would like a concern raised. They may prefer a quiet talk at home or time alone with a clinician. They may want you nearby for part of a visit and outside for another part. Age, safety, and care rules affect what is possible, but their view still matters.
Make space for the answer to be about something you did not expect. School stress, a friendship, pain, or fear about your health may be what they most want to discuss. You can know the family history while staying open to the problem they are trying to tell you about.
When a professional conversation helps
A pediatrician can help review the concern and arrange child or adolescent mental health assessment when needed. Bring the usual baseline, the change, its timing, and the impact on school, home, or relationships. Include the young person’s account, not only the adult’s interpretation.
Genetic counseling may help a family understand inherited susceptibility, uncertain estimates, and decisions about testing. It should not be advertised as a route to an accurate predictive bipolar test. Ask about the counselor’s experience with psychiatric family questions.
Seek prompt assessment for a sustained concerning change or major impairment. Psychosis, severe confusion, immediate self-harm danger, or inability to keep someone safe requires urgent or emergency care. Call 911 for immediate medical or physical danger; calling or texting 988 (the Suicide & Crisis Lifeline) can help when the next step is uncertain.11

Frequently asked questions
What does heritability actually mean?
It is a population-level measure of variation associated with genetic differences under particular conditions. It is not the chance your child inherits bipolar disorder, and it does not divide one person’s illness into genetic and environmental percentages. A highly heritable condition can still have uncertain outcomes for individual families.
What is my child’s risk?
Family history increases risk, but there is no single precise answer for one child. Estimates differ with age, diagnosis, recruitment, and healthcare records. The Danish table in this article is an internally compatible research comparison, not a personal forecast. Ask which outcome and follow-up period a number describes before using it in a family decision.
Does having two affected parents change the evidence?
Yes. Studies generally find greater familial association when both parents are affected, but the groups are often small and estimates are uncertain. Different studies also count different diagnoses and ages. The evidence can inform planning and access to assessment. It should not be used to blame parents or define a child’s future.
Can a DNA test tell us?
Current consumer DNA tests and psychiatric polygenic scores cannot settle whether a child will develop bipolar disorder. Many variants contribute, ancestry and study methods affect interpretation, and association is different from useful prediction. Genetic counseling may help explain these limits. Drug-metabolism testing, when relevant to care, answers a different question from predicting a diagnosis.
What should I watch for in a teenager?
Notice sustained, meaningful changes from their usual sleep need, energy, mood, behavior, judgment, and function, especially when several occur together. Ask how the young person feels. Ordinary conflict or a late night does not diagnose bipolar disorder. Major impairment, psychosis, or dangerous behavior deserves assessment rather than being dismissed as ordinary adolescence.
Can I lower risk without making my child feel monitored?
You can support sleep opportunity, predictable care, open discussion, and help with current distress. These are health supports, not proven guarantees against bipolar disorder. Avoid daily scoring or treating ordinary behavior as evidence of illness. Let the child keep an identity beyond family history, and make adult support responsible for the parent’s care.
